Land Use Planning

Beginning in Fall 2005, the Office of Planning begab engaging community residents in developing land use plans for the following sections of these corridors.

Targeted Corridor Boundaries
Pennsylvania Avenue, SE Second Street, SE to Southern Avenue
Georgia Avenue, NW Decatur Street, NW to Eastern Avenue
Benning Road, NE/SE Bladensburg Road to Southern Avenue, SE
Martin Luther King, Jr. Avenue, SE and South Capitol Street Lebaum Street, SE at Martin Luther King, Jr. Avenue to Southern Avenue at South Capitol Street
Nannie Helen Burroughs Avenue, NE/ Deanwood/Watts Branch Park To be determined

Land use plans exist for all other sections of the corridors and are serving as implementation guides for public actions and private investments through Great Streets.
